Q: What is the WOMAC pain scale, and why is it used in joint health evaluation? 

A: The WOMAC pain scale (Western Ontario and McMaster Universities Osteoarthritis Index) is a validated clinical outcome tool that captures participant-reported joint discomfort across standardized domains, enabling comparison across populations. Q: What are cartilage regeneration biomarkers? 

A: Cartilage regeneration biomarkers are objective biological measures that detect activity at the tissue level of cartilage. Unlike participant-reported outcomes, which capture how individuals describe their comfort and mobility, biomarkers provide a direct, measurable signal from the tissue itself. In the joint health supplement category, their inclusion in a clinical study is uncommon.
